Brothers in law Jesse and Laurance are bringing some variety to the late night food scene in Missoula. Whiz Kid makes the famous no fuss cheesesteak (or cheeseshroom) sandwich you desire! We use only Amoroso rolls direct from Philadelphia, to anchor our cheesesteak in its hometown roots. With this iconic bread as a base, combined with the best ingredients available in Montana, we craft a delicious sandwich unique to the Mountain West. We offer just a couple of sides to enhance your meal. First we have hand cut, fried corn chips seasoned with our very own blend of chili cheese spices. Second is a dill pickle.
